Default chrome wheel type?

These are the chrome wheels on the 08 vert that I purchased yesterday. The car has 5000 orig mi and these are the factory wheels rpo code QX3. I like them but I thought the 08's came with the gumby wheels. Anyone know anything about the wheels on an 08?

Q44 Competition Gray Aluminum Wheels (Z06) 395 395
QX3 Chrome Aluminum Wheels (Z06) 5,101 1,995
Q9V Chrome Forged Aluminum Wheels 2,932 1,850
QG7 Polished Forged Aluminum Wheels 5,412 1,295
QL9 Polished Aluminum Wheels (Z06) 970 1,495
QX1 Competition Gray Aluminum Wheels 1,781 395
QX3 Chrome Aluminum Wheels 9,626 1,850

No Gumby's in 08

QX3 started out the '08 year, then there was a time when there was a choice of those or the Gumbys, then the QX3 ran out and the year was finished with Gumbys.

chrome wheels for '08 WERE the older-style as pictured. gumbies WERE available in '08 but only as polished, forged, wheels, not chrome. some have claimed (and they could be right) that very late in the '08 model run, chrome gumbies became available. I'll let others who actually got them on their new '08s speak.

should be noted tho that some polished wheels when new are pretty close to looking chrome as long as there's not a side-by-side comparo. then, it usually becomes obvious which is chrome and which isn't.

In 2008, QG7 was the code for the highly polished "Gumby" wheels.

5412 sets were sold. 2009 was the last year for the QG7 wheels and

only 1989 sets were sold.
